ENDOSCOPIC SPINE SURGERY

Endoscopic Spine Surgery is a technique wherein Surgery is done through less than 1cm incision using a special instrument called endoscope .

MINIMALLY INVASIVE
SPINE SURGERY

Minimally Invasive Spine Surgery (MISS) or Key Hole Spine Surgery is a technique wherein Surgery is done through tubular system under microscopic guidance.

Scoliosis Surgery

Spine deformity surgery is performed under O-Arm navigation guidance for accuracy and Neuro-Monitoring to avoid any neurological damage and to give best possible correction.

SPONDYLOLISTHESIS

Spondylolisthesis is a condition wherein one vertebra slips forward on top of the lower vertebra. In such cases, endoscopic fusion/decompressio is done to relieve symptoms.

CERVICAL SPINE SURGERY
& DISC REPLACEMENT

Cervical spondylosis is age related wear and tear of the neck bones and discs. It is said to affect most people by the age of 60, but commonly we even see youngsters with this problem. This results in degeneration of the disc in the neck as well as bony overgrowth.

REVISION SPINE SURGERY

Spine surgery can fail if there is recurrence of slip disc even after disc removal surgery. This can occur either at the same level or some other level. Sometimes, spine surgery can fail due to failure to use spine implants at the time of first surgery.

spine Tuberculosis
Surgery

Amongst bones, it is the spine (neck and back) that is the most common site of tuberculosis. Tuberculosis can strike anyone at any age and there may be no specific predisposing factor in most patients. Children and elderly; people with decreased immunity.
